In order for the SHAPE Team to develop and design the best personalized therapy and training program for you, we must first gain a full understanding of how you move and function from head to toe. The assessment consists of the following components: medical history, body composition and measurements, lower and upper body strength tests, core stability, previous sports injury evaluation, health risk assessment and a biomechanical scan.

All of our personalized programs are overseen by a therapist (chiropractor or physiotherapist), a regulated health care professional, who ensures that your program is functionally designed to simulate movement in both everyday life and sport.

Our ITT program follows 4 main principles known as PARS:
  • Posture – Muscle Balance
  • Alignment – Joint Structure and Function
  • Range of Motion – Joint Range of Motion and Muscle Flexibility
  • Stability – Core Balance
Our therapists and conditioning specialists will analyze your PARS during your first treatment/session utilizing a functional movement screen consisting of nine different tests. Should any pain or limitation be detected, we will proceed to integrate your training with therapy treatments to ensure your pain is alleviated and the problem does not recur. Furthermore, corrective exercise techniques will be used throughout your High Performance Personal Training (HPPT) sessions to address any limitations found through your functional movement screen in conjunction with addressing your fitness or sport-specific goals.

How the SHAPE PARS system applies to both training and therapy:
  • Training:
    • Posture and Alignment – Corrective dynamic exercises and stretches consisting of squatting, lunging, balancing, rotating, pushing and pulling movements will be utilized to address your muscle balance and joint structure and function.
    • Range of Motion / Flexibility – Foam Roller Exercises, The Stick, Active Isolated Stretching Techniques (AIS) and Proprioceptive Neuromuscular Facilitation (PNF) stretching will be utilized to enhance muscle recovery and regeneration in conjunction with increasing your flexibility
    • Stability – Stabilization exercises and functional fitness exercises will be implemented throughout your training program along with corrective exercises – all programs begin in Stage 1 addressing Muscle Endurance, Activation and Stabilization ... Read More
  • Therapy:
    • Posture – Soft tissue techniques such as Active Release Techniques (ART®) in conjunction with Medical Acupuncture/Intramuscular stimulation to reduce muscle tightness and stiffness
    • Alignment – Manual Therapy such as mobilizations and manipulation for joint structure and function
    • Range of Motion/Flexibility – Stretching techniques such as AIS and PNF to reduce tissue stiffness and increase range of motion
    • Stability – Core Stabilization Exercises as everything starts from the core for muscle activation and stabilization
